## Runbook: Account Recovery for the Sweeper Bot (Project Tidewrack)

So the orphaned-resource sweeper lost its service account again — happens roughly once a quarter when the Halloway rotation job races the credential refresh. Don't panic and definitely don't disable the sweeper; orphaned volumes pile up fast and the bill gets ugly. Instead, hop onto the Tidewrack admin node, stop the sweeper daemon cleanly, and kick off the account recovery wizard. It'll ask for the recovery passphrase, which you'll find right below this line.

strongbox words: prawyn-fenmir

# DeltaPane — large-file diff viewer
# On-call notes: this env file drives the chunked-diff worker.
# If diffs over 500 MB time out, check PANE_CHUNK_SIZE first;
# the default of 8 MB is usually fine. PANE_TMP_DIR must point
# at the fast scratch volume or performance tanks. The worker
# also authenticates against the Quillbrook blob store, and
# that credential is set on the line directly below.

env line for fafof-fahag: LEDGER_TOKEN5=f8790

Step 4: Swap the ScanBridge adapter. Before merging, verify the legacy Korvax scanner polling loop is fully removed — the new integration is event-driven, and leftover polling will double-count scans. Confirm the decoder fallback path handles damaged barcodes the same way the old driver did; Anneli's test fixtures cover this. Once the adapter compiles cleanly against the new SDK, update the service so it starts with the configuration values given below.

settings of kajep-kawip:
[zorys]
host = zorys.urlaqgrid.corp
user = zorys_svc
database = zorys_prod

Environment variables for Pagewright incremental rebuilds. The rebuild worker watches the content bus and re-renders only pages whose source digests changed, so a full rebuild should be rare; if you see one during on-call, check REBUILD_SCOPE first, since an empty value silently means "all." DIGEST_CACHE_DIR must point at persistent storage or every deploy becomes a full rebuild. Finally, the worker pulls draft content from the Inkwell API using a read token, which goes on the line after this one.

vault entry, yajop-bafop: ARCHIVE_KEY3=8d4